Helpful Comparison Insights

When selecting the best pressure washer nozzle for your needs, the biggest choice is between fixed-angle tips and turbo nozzles.

Turbo nozzles (like the AURORA CAR and Jeogejin) are fantastic for deep cleaning concrete, removing moss, and tackling rust because they combine the aggressive force of a 0-degree jet with a wider cleaning path. However, they are too intense and usually risk damaging softer surfaces like wood decking, vinyl siding, or automotive paint. Use turbo nozzles only for very durable, heavily soiled areas.

For most day-to-day tasks, the fixed-angle nozzle kits (Tool Daily, Twinkle Star, Hourleey) are necessary. The 15° (Yellow) and 25° (Green) tips are the workhorses; they balance power and coverage perfectly for general siding, deck maintenance, and patio furniture. The 40° (White) is the safest option for vehicles and delicate wood.

Crucially, always check your orifice size (GPM). Using a tip with an orifice that is too small for your machine’s GPM rating can cause excessive back pressure, potentially damaging your pump and risking serious injury. Look at the numbers stamped on your current tips or check your machine’s manual before choosing a replacement best pressure washer nozzle.

Common Questions About the Best Pressure Washer Nozzle

What is an “Orifice Size” and why is it important for my machine?

The orifice size (usually measured in GPM or “gallons per minute”) refers to the diameter of the hole in the nozzle tip. This size is critical because it dictates how much water can pass through the tip at a given pressure (PSI). If you use an orifice that is too small for your machine’s GPM rating, you restrict the water flow, causing excessive back pressure that can overheat and damage your pressure washer pump. Always match the orifice size to your pressure washer’s specifications to ensure safety and optimal performance.

Which pressure washer nozzle angle should I use for washing my car?

For washing vehicles or other delicate painted surfaces, you should always use the widest possible angle to reduce impact pressure. The 40-degree (White) tip is generally the safest choice. Keep the nozzle at least 10–12 inches away from the surface and use a sweeping motion to avoid paint damage. Never use 0° (Red) or turbo nozzles on cars.

Are turbo nozzles safe to use on wooden decks?

Generally, no. Turbo nozzles, while effective for concrete, concentrate a powerful, oscillating jet that can easily chip or gouge soft surfaces like wood, leading to permanent surface damage. When cleaning wooden decks or fencing, it is safer to use a 25-degree (Green) or 40-degree (White) tip and keep the PSI under 1500 to protect the material.

What do the different color codes mean on pressure washer nozzle tips?

The color codes represent the specific spray pattern or angle (sometimes called the fan angle):
* Red (0°): Pinpoint accuracy, maximum force. Only for spot cleaning extreme stains on concrete.
* Yellow (15°): Aggressive cleaning for hard, narrow surfaces.
* Green (25°): General purpose cleaning, great for most household dirt and grime.
* White (40°): Wide fan, gentle pressure. Best for vehicles, windows, and soft surfaces.
* Black (65°): Low-pressure soap application or rinsing.

Can I use a garden hose high-pressure wand attachment with my high-PSI pressure washer?

No. Products marketed as “high-pressure wands” for garden hoses (like the Jet Flux or FANHAO) are designed for very low pressure and use a standard garden hose connector. They cannot withstand the force generated by a true high pressure cleaning machine and attempting to connect them would be extremely dangerous and likely result in immediate equipment failure.

If my pressure washer is rated for 3000 PSI, can I use a 4000 PSI rated nozzle?

Yes, absolutely. The pressure rating on the nozzle indicates the maximum pressure it can safely handle. As long as your pressure washer’s operational PSI is below the nozzle’s maximum rating (e.g., your 3000 PSI machine with a 4000 PSI nozzle), the nozzle will function perfectly and safely.
